Working with Children with Specialized Diets, Allergies and Feeding Issues
Course Description:
Food allergies affect 1 in 13 children in the United States; with young children being affected the most. Food allergies, food sensitivities and other feeding issues are an increasing concern for early education and care programs. Participants will be introduced to the health and safety needs of children with special dietary needs and ways to support these children and collaborate with families and health professionals. Participants will begin to develop their own individual health care plan for children with special diets, allergies, and specialized feeding issues in their program.
